Rio Vista, Fort Lauderdale, FL Local Guide

Cheapest Available Rio Vista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in the Rio Vista area of Fort Lauderdale, FL is a 1 Bed unit found at 627 SE 4th Ave priced from $1,650. The Falls At Marina Bay has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,876. Here are the most affordable Rio Vista apartments for rent in Fort Lauderdale, FL:

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Rio Vista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Rio Vista?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Rio Vista is under $3,318.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Rio Vista?

The cheapest apartment in Rio Vista is 627 SE 4th Ave which is listed at $1,650, while the average apartment in Rio Vista costs $6,658.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Rio Vista?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 5 regular apartments in Rio Vista that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
